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Implement attribute properties #1659

Closed
mlewand opened this issue Mar 28, 2019 · 1 comment · Fixed by ckeditor/ckeditor5-engine#1711
Closed

Implement attribute properties #1659

mlewand opened this issue Mar 28, 2019 · 1 comment · Fixed by ckeditor/ckeditor5-engine#1711
Labels
package:engine type:feature This issue reports a feature request (an idea for a new functionality or a missing option).
Milestone

Comments

@mlewand
Copy link
Contributor

mlewand commented Mar 28, 2019

Is this a bug report or feature request?

🆕 Feature request

💻 Version of CKEditor

CKEditor v5 @ 12.0.0

📋 Steps to reproduce

Based on discussion in #908 (comment) emerged the idea to provide an API that will allow to mark attributes with metadata.

First we need to use it to describe whether or not attribute should be considered as visual formatting or not.

The default implementation will not restrict property names, so it could be used by plugin developers for better extensibility.

@mlewand mlewand added type:feature This issue reports a feature request (an idea for a new functionality or a missing option). status:confirmed package:engine labels Mar 28, 2019
@mlewand mlewand added this to the iteration 23 milestone Mar 28, 2019
@oleq
Copy link
Member

oleq commented Mar 28, 2019

Just a reminder for myself: we should make this sort of metadata inspectable.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
package:engine type:feature This issue reports a feature request (an idea for a new functionality or a missing option).
Projects
None yet
2 participants